Whites Pond
Whites Pond is in Providence County, Rhode Island. Whites Pond is situated nearby to the neighborhood West Glocester, as well as near Clarkville.Places of Interest

George Washington Memorial State Forest
Forest
George Washington Memorial State Forest is a state forest on the Putnam Pike near the village of Chepachet in the town of Glocester, Rhode Island. The forest was founded in 1932 as Rhode Island's first state forest. George Washington Memorial State Forest is situated 2½ miles north of Whites Pond.

Daniel’s Village Archeological Site
Locality
Photo: Magicpiano,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Daniel's Village Archeological Site is a historic industrial archaeological site in Killingly, Connecticut. Located in the vicinity of the crossing of Putnam Road and the Five Mile River, the area is the site of one of the earliest textile mills in Connecticut. Daniel’s Village Archeological Site is situated 4 miles west of Whites Pond.
